What is a Humboldt Penguin?

The Humboldt Penguin, also known as the Chilean Penguin or the Peruvian Penguin, is a fascinating species of penguin that inhabits the coasts of South America. Named after the Humboldt Current, which flows along the western coast of the continent, these charismatic birds have adapted to life in the ocean and are well-suited to their marine environment.

A. Description of Humboldt Penguin

The Humboldt Penguin is a medium-sized penguin species, with adults typically measuring around 22 to 28 inches in height and weighing between 8 and 13 pounds. They have a stocky build, which helps them to conserve heat in the cold waters they inhabit. Their feathers are predominantly black on the back and white on the front, with a distinctive black band across their chest and a black stripe that extends from their eyes to their chin.

One of the most striking features of the Humboldt Penguin is its pinkish skin patches around the eyes, which become more vibrant during breeding season. These patches are believed to help regulate their body temperature by dissipating excess heat. Additionally, they have strong, webbed feet that are adapted for swimming and diving.

B. Humboldt Penguin Scientific Name

The scientific name of the Humboldt Penguin is Spheniscus humboldti. This name is derived from the Greek word “spheniskos,” meaning “wedge-shaped,” and the Latin word “humboldti,” which honors the renowned German naturalist Alexander von Humboldt. The species was first described by German zoologist Johann Reinhold Forster in 1781.

The Habitat of Humboldt Penguins

Humboldt penguins, also known as Spheniscus humboldti, are fascinating creatures that inhabit the coastal regions of South America. Let’s explore their habitat, location, and the challenges they face in their natural environment.

A. Where Do Humboldt Penguins Live?

Humboldt penguins are native to the Humboldt Current, a cold oceanic current that flows along the western coast of South America. This unique current brings nutrient-rich waters from the depths of the Pacific Ocean, creating an ideal environment for the penguins to thrive.

These charismatic birds can be found in two main countries: Chile and Peru. In Chile, they inhabit the rocky coastline from Isla Foca in the north to Isla Chañaral in the south. In Peru, they can be found along the coast from Punta Pariñas in the north to Punta San Juan in the south.

C. Humboldt Penguin National Reserve: A Sanctuary for Penguins

To protect the vulnerable Humboldt penguins and their habitat, several conservation efforts have been put in place. One notable initiative is the establishment of the Humboldt Penguin National Reserve in Chile. This reserve, located on the Choros and Damas Islands, provides a safe haven for these endangered penguins.

The Humboldt Penguin National Reserve is not only home to a significant population of penguins but also serves as a breeding ground for other coastal birds and marine mammals. The reserve’s protected status ensures that these species can continue to thrive undisturbed.

The Diet of Humboldt Penguins

Humboldt penguins, also known as Spheniscus humboldti, are a species of penguin that can be found along the coasts of Chile and Peru. These adorable creatures have a diverse diet that consists primarily of fish, but they also consume other marine organisms to meet their nutritional needs.

A. What Do Humboldt Penguins Eat in the Wild?

In the wild, Humboldt penguins primarily feed on small fish such as anchovies, sardines, and hake. These fish are abundant in the Humboldt Current, a cold oceanic current that flows along the western coast of South America. The penguins use their streamlined bodies and strong flippers to swim swiftly through the water, allowing them to catch their prey with ease.

Apart from fish, Humboldt penguins also consume squid and crustaceans, including krill and shrimp. These additional food sources provide them with a varied diet and ensure they receive the necessary nutrients for their survival. The penguins‘ diet is essential for maintaining their energy levels and supporting their overall health.

B. How Do Humboldt Penguins Get Their Food?

Humboldt penguins are skilled hunters and have adapted to their marine environment to efficiently obtain their food. They use their keen eyesight to spot schools of fish swimming near the water’s surface. Once they have identified their prey, the penguins dive into the water, using their wings as flippers to propel themselves forward.

Underwater, Humboldt penguins can reach impressive speeds of up to 20 miles per hour (32 kilometers per hour) as they chase after their prey. They have sharp, hooked beaks that allow them to catch and hold onto their slippery meals. The penguinsstreamlined bodies and webbed feet aid in their agility and maneuverability underwater, enabling them to navigate through the water with precision.

B. How Do Humboldt Penguins Communicate?

Communication plays a vital role in the social dynamics of Humboldt penguins. These birds use a variety of vocalizations and body language to convey messages to their colony members. One of the most common vocalizations is a braying call, which sounds like a donkey’s bray. This call is used for various purposes, such as attracting mates, defending territory, and warning others of potential dangers.

In addition to vocalizations, Humboldt penguins also communicate through visual displays. They use their body posture, flapping their flippers, and head movements to convey different messages. For example, a penguin with an erect posture and flippers held outwards may be displaying aggression, while a relaxed posture and flippers by the side indicate a more peaceful demeanor.

C. When Do Humboldt Penguins Stop Breeding?

Humboldt penguins typically reach sexual maturity between the ages of 3 and 5 years. Once they reach this stage, they start forming monogamous pairs and engage in breeding activities. Breeding season for Humboldt penguins varies depending on their location, but it generally occurs between March and September.

After successful mating, the female Humboldt penguin lays one or two eggs in a nest made of guano and pebbles. Both parents take turns incubating the eggs, which typically hatch after about 40 days. Once the chicks hatch, they are cared for by both parents, who take turns feeding and protecting them. The chicks remain in the nest for around 2 to 3 months before they fledge and start exploring their surroundings.

Humboldt penguins usually breed annually, but there are instances where they may skip breeding seasons. Factors such as food availability, environmental conditions, and the overall health of the colony can influence their breeding patterns. In some cases, if the resources are limited or the population is under stress, Humboldt penguins may choose to forgo breeding altogether.

The Conservation Status of Humboldt Penguins

A. How Many Humboldt Penguins are Left in the Wild?

The Humboldt penguin, also known as the Chilean penguin or Spheniscus humboldti, is a species of penguin that inhabits the coasts of Peru and Chile. These adorable creatures are part of the larger group of penguins known as the South American penguins. However, despite their charm and popularity, the Humboldt penguin population is facing significant challenges.

The exact number of Humboldt penguins left in the wild is difficult to determine with absolute certainty. However, according to the International Union for Conservation of Nature (IUCN), the estimated population size is around 32,000 individuals. This number, though relatively small compared to other penguin species, is a cause for concern.

B. Humboldt Penguin Endangered: An Overview

The Humboldt penguin is currently classified as “Vulnerable” on the IUCN Red List of Threatened Species. This means that the species is at a high risk of extinction in the wild if the current threats and challenges persist. The main factors contributing to their vulnerable status are habitat loss, overfishing, and climate change.

The Humboldt penguin relies on the Humboldt Current, a cold, nutrient-rich ocean current that flows along the western coast of South America, for its survival. However, climate change is causing disruptions in this current, affecting the availability of food for the penguins. Additionally, the destruction of their natural habitat due to human activities, such as coastal development and pollution, further exacerbates their vulnerability.

C. How Many Humboldt Penguins Die Each Year?

The Humboldt penguin faces numerous threats that result in a significant number of deaths each year. One of the major causes of mortality is the depletion of their primary food source, which leads to starvation. Overfishing in the Humboldt Current reduces the availability of fish and squid, forcing the penguins to travel longer distances in search of food. This increased foraging effort puts additional stress on the birds and can result in higher mortality rates.

Furthermore, the destruction of nesting sites and disturbance during the breeding season also contribute to penguin deaths. Human activities, such as tourism and guano harvesting on the islands where the penguins breed, disrupt their natural behavior and can lead to abandonment of nests and eggs.

While it is challenging to determine the exact number of Humboldt penguins that die each year, the combination of these threats has a significant impact on their population. Conservation efforts are crucial to mitigate these threats and ensure the long-term survival of this charismatic species.

The Impact of Pollution on Humboldt Penguins

A. How Are Humboldt Penguins Affected by Pollution?

Pollution has become a significant concern for the survival of Humboldt penguins, a species native to the coasts of Chile and Peru. These charming birds, also known as Chilean penguins or Peruvian penguins, are facing numerous challenges due to human activities that pollute their natural habitat.

One of the primary ways pollution affects Humboldt penguins is through the contamination of their food sources. These marine birds heavily rely on the Humboldt Current, a cold, nutrient-rich ocean current that flows along the western coast of South America. The current supports a diverse ecosystem, providing an abundant supply of fish and other marine life that form the penguins’ diet.

However, pollution, particularly from industrial and agricultural activities, introduces harmful substances into the ocean. These pollutants can accumulate in the fish and other prey species that Humboldt penguins feed on, leading to bioaccumulation. As a result, when penguins consume contaminated prey, they are exposed to toxic substances that can have detrimental effects on their health.

Pollution also poses a threat to the breeding and nesting habits of Humboldt penguins. These birds typically breed on guano islands, which are rocky outcrops covered in layers of bird droppings. The guano provides essential nutrients for the growth of vegetation, creating suitable nesting sites for the penguins. However, pollution can contaminate these islands, disrupting the delicate balance of nutrients and affecting the availability of suitable breeding grounds for the penguins.

Furthermore, pollution can directly impact the reproductive success of Humboldt penguins. Studies have shown that exposure to pollutants can lead to reproductive disorders, such as reduced fertility and abnormal eggshell formation. These issues can result in lower hatching rates and overall population decline.

Frequently Asked Questions

1. What are Humboldt Penguins?

Humboldt Penguins, also known as Chilean Penguins or Peruvian Penguins, are a South American penguin species. They are named after the cold Humboldt current in which they swim. The scientific name for this species is Spheniscus humboldti.

2. Where do Humboldt Penguins live?

Humboldt Penguins are found along the coasts of Peru and Chile, typically on rocky mainland shores, especially near cliffs, or on islands. They are particularly associated with the guano islands, where they breed and feed.

3. How many Humboldt Penguins are left in the wild?

The exact number of Humboldt Penguins left in the wild is uncertain due to their wide distribution and inaccessible habitats. However, it’s estimated that there are around 32,000 individuals left, making them an endangered species.

4. What do Humboldt Penguins eat?

Humboldt Penguins primarily feed on small fish, such as anchovies and sardines, and squid. Their diet can vary depending on the availability of food in their habitat.

5. How are Humboldt Penguins affected by pollution?

Pollution, particularly oil spills, can have a devastating impact on Humboldt Penguins. It can damage their feathers, which compromises their ability to maintain body temperature and buoyancy. Ingesting oil can also damage their internal organs and lead to death.

6. How do Humboldt Penguins protect themselves?

Humboldt Penguins have several adaptations to protect themselves. Their black and white coloration serves as camouflage against predators. When threatened, they can also use their strong flippers and beak to defend themselves.

7. What are the main threats to Humboldt Penguins?

The main threats to Humboldt Penguins include overfishing, which reduces their food supply, habitat loss due to guano harvesting, climate change, and pollution, particularly from oil spills. They are also affected by human disturbance in their breeding areas.

8. What are the conservation efforts for Humboldt Penguins?

Conservation efforts for Humboldt Penguins include protection of breeding sites, regulation of fishing around their habitats, and rescue and rehabilitation of oiled or injured penguins. Zoos and aquariums also participate in captive breeding programs to help boost their population.

9. How long do Humboldt Penguins live?

The lifespan of a Humboldt Penguin can vary, but on average, they live up to 20 years in the wild. In captivity, with optimal conditions and care, they can live up to 30 years.

10. What do Humboldt Penguins look like?

Humboldt Penguins are medium-sized penguins, with a black head and a white front. They have a black band running in an inverted horseshoe shape on their front and a white border running from behind the eye, around the black ear-coverts and chin, to join on the throat. They are about 56 to 70 cm (22 to 28 in) in height.
